before complaining about the cost, you have to do some research. I dont think you can build one pedal with CNC Parts for unter 500€/$. Maybe if you have the machine to make it your self. Motor costs 100€, JKK60-Rail with shiping 140€ (simucube uses hiwin rail in his ultimate products (cost for normal people arround 950$ one rail, i dont speak about the ali hiwi rails which are arround 330$) ), Powerboard, Controller board, 50€, Loadcell 50€, Powersuply 25€, ->365€ for mechanical Parts + some little things like bolds, wires... . Than the 3d Printed parts or the CNC Parts, if you can do it by yourself, arround add another 200€ per pedal. So arround 6xx€ for one pedal. Yah still cheaper than simucube. But simucube is a company an had to pay the working people. You have to consider the development time, where you not making any money. The advertising you have to do, the software updates etc. So this things costs the most. I think in the future we will see more active pedals, which will costs defenitly less
